Mesothelioma is a deadly cancer that is a result of the lining that protects organs inside the body, such as the lungs. The cause of the disease is exposure to asbestos, which was used extensively from the late 1800s until the 1970s.

Due to its fire-proof properties and low price asbestos was utilized in a myriad of products. Construction materials such as insulations automobile parts, and shipbuilding materials were all used. Its toxicity was not discovered until decades after the material's usage, and the victims who were exposed often suffered from m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ses.

Fees

When choosing a mesothelioma lawyer it is important to know what your attorney will charge for their services. The majority of asbestos lawyers are contracted on a contingency basis, and their fees are based on a percentage of the settlement amount. The exact structure of fees can differ from firm to firm. However, attorneys typically will take between 33 and 40 percent of your settlement. Attorneys can also charge expenses such as filing and deposition fees, research fees and travel costs.
